Geda Solarlifts – Different Modalities For Your Application AreaUnique Concept: The Solar PlatformGeda Solarlift – One Device, Several AdvantagesThe GEDA Solarlift has particularly been designed for working with sensitive materials and offers a specific solar platform for a safe transport of expensive solar panels. The platform provides a specially developed plastic surface and an extra fixation possibility which can be adjusted as desired.
